Output 2943036a2d156c6159c38dd17e957943f62508b34fc54ecf2f7bb83b2085a9aa:0

value
4808970682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e3926d1781f279da7cc4638a7336539734c610 OP_EQUAL
address
3KBdcAKfHkwLV2cKHt4V1xGKsQJabCP6XT
transaction
2943036a2d156c6159c38dd17e957943f62508b34fc54ecf2f7bb83b2085a9aa
spent
true